Somehow i think hardcore UT players will find that show a farce.

UT will be played on commercial adjusted maps, so the adience can see someting too, enforcer, minigun, snipergun are removed.

It has to be "acceptable to the viewing public in taste and decency" which removes the taunts, and giblets, no bloodgore around.
All the "spice" of UT seem to be left out for the public.

Further i think that the moralgeeks have now more to whine about of senceless violence on TV i hope not, but knowing those whiners, they grab any excuse to ban such games.

I do like the idear of an UT/FPS gameshow, don't get me wrong, but i think the genereal public isn't ready for it :(
